Plisov, Viktor Vasilyevich

Viktor Vasilyevich Plissov (born September 14, 1935, Maikop ) - Soviet state and party leader. Member of the CPSU since 1963; first secretary of the Khakassky regional committee of the CPSU (1982-1983), first secretary of Nazarovsky (1969-1972) and Achinsky (1972-1974) city committee of the CPSU, delegate of the XXVII Congress of the CPSU . Chairman of the Krasnoyarsk Regional Executive Committee (1983-1988). Deputy of the Council of Nationalities of the Supreme Soviet of the 11th convocation (1984-1989) of the Khakass Autonomous Region [1] . Deputy of the Krasnoyarsk Regional Council of People's Deputies (1973-88).

Biography

Born on September 14, 1935 in Maykop . In 1960, he graduated with honors from the Moscow Energy Institute with a degree in hydraulic engineering and construction engineering. In the same year he came to Divnnogorsk for the construction of the Krasnoyarsk Hydroelectric Power Station , and worked as a master of the construction department of the “Grazhdanstroy”. In December 1960, he was elected secretary of the Komsomol committee of the Construction Directorate of KrasnoyarskGESstroy, and in 1961 the construction itself was declared the All-Union Komsomol shock construction of the Krasnoyarsk Hydroelectric Power Plant. With the formation of the city - the first secretary of the city committee of the Komsomol Divnogorsk. In those years, the Komsomol, together with the whole team of hydraulic builders, with the teams of other enterprises and organizations of the region, solved complex production and social problems of building the largest in the world Krasnoyarsk hydroelectric station. For the successful solution of these tasks, for the great contribution of Komsomol and youth to the construction of the Krasnoyarsk Hydroelectric Power Station and the city of Divnogorsk, active work on educating young people and in connection with the 50th anniversary of the Komsomol on October 25, 1968 by the Decree of the Presidium of the Supreme Soviet of the USSR Divnogorsk city Komsomol organization, the legendary Komsomol leader which was in his time Victor Plisov, awarded the Order of the Red Banner of Labor.

In 1964-1969, Viktor Vasilyevich worked as a foreman, head of the department for managing the main buildings of the Construction Department of KrasnoyarskGESstroy, and he took up one of the most difficult issues - for the first time in such harsh conditions to check the continuous concreting system in action. It was an experiment not just of national importance, but a scientific and technical project that was far ahead of its time. This manifested all the life credo of V.V. Plisova, who, after years, he formulated in a very beautiful phrase: “From a production point of view, it is not worthwhile to reinvent the perpetual motion engine, but from a historical ... Such inventions, even if they did not take place, change life or the attitude to life.” [2]

Later, working as a secretary of the Krasnoyarsk Regional Committee of the CPSU, he continued cooperation with the creators of the hydropower power of the Krasnoyarsk Territory and the Khakass Autonomous Region that was part of it at the time, leading the regional coordination Council of the Commonwealth of Leningrad and Krasnoyarsk enterprises and organizations for the construction of the Sayano-Shushenskaya HPP.

During his tenure in various senior positions in the Krasnoyarsk Territory, he oversaw the construction of the Main, Kureyskoy, Boguchanskaya and other hydropower stations of the Krasnoyarsk Territory, Berezovskaya State District Power Plant and other facilities of the Kansk-Achinsk fuel and energy complex, power lines and other energy facilities of the region. He dealt with the construction of sports facilities of the 1982 USSR V Spartakiad of the Peoples of the USSR, health care facilities, culture, education and science, industry and many, many other issues, the solution of which contributed to the rapid development of the economy of the Krasnoyarsk Territory and its social sphere in the 1960s – 1980s. century.

In 1963 he was admitted to the CPSU.

He was elected a delegate of the All-Union rally of young builders of Siberia and the Far East in Krasnoyarsk in 1963, the XIV Congress of the Komsomol and the XXVII Congress of the CPSU , the IX World Festival of Youth and Students in Sofia . By the way, at the XIV Congress of the Komsomol, in April 1962, Viktor Vasilyevich invited the first cosmonaut Yu.A. Gagarin in Divnogorsk, and in September 1963, Yuri Alekseevich was a guest of the city Divnogorsk.

Since 1969 - on the party work: first secretary of Nazarovsky, and then Achinsk city committee of the CPSU, since 1974 - secretary of the Krasnoyarsk regional committee of the party, since 1982 - first secretary of the Khakassky regional committee of the CPSU. Since 1983 - Chairman of the Executive Committee of the Krasnoyarsk Regional Council of People's Deputies.

In April 1988, he was appointed Deputy Minister of Heavy, Energy and Transport Engineering of the USSR - Head of the Main Directorate for Design and Capital Construction.

In 1991–1998, he worked as Deputy Chairman of the Management Board of the machine-building concern Khimneftemash, Vice President of AO Khimmash ( Moscow ), First Deputy Commercial Director of the Corporation Montazhspetsstroy.

Awards and titles

  • three orders of the Red Banner of Labor (1971, 1976, 1981)
  • Order of Friendship of Peoples (1985)
  • Medal "For Valiant Labor. In commemoration of the centenary of the birth of V. I. Lenin " (1970)
  • Medal "For the Development of Virgin Lands" (1974)
  • Medal "For the construction of the Baikal-Amur Mainline" (1984)
  • badge of the Central Committee of the Komsomol "For active work in the Komsomol"
  • Honorary badge of the Komsomol.
  • Freeman of Divnogorsk
  • Honorary Citizen of the Krasnoyarsk Territory
